Hello, thanks in advance for any advice.
I have been loading mp3s onto my SD chip (after formatting via the phone menu), then installing the chip into the phone and initializing the library. There are always a few mp3's (10 or 20) that don't get recognized by the phone, as well as some filenames that appear with a question mark as the first character of the filename. Those won't play either.
I have tried shortening the song titles to under 40 characters. I have gone through the ID3 tags to make sure the information matches the filename on the song - no results. Not sure what else to try, has anyone else run into this problem?
Thanks again.
